Doogh (Persian Yogurt Drink)

Doogh, also known as ayran or tan, is a salty goat or ewe yogurt beverage that is popular in Syria, Lebanon and Turkey.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up sheep's or goat's yogurt cold
  • ½ cup still or sparkling water cold
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• fresh mint or dried
  • crushed ice
Equipment
  • blender

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Add the yoghurt and water in a blender.
  2. Mix for 1 minute until frothy.
  3. Pour the mixture into a glass.
  4. Add crushed ice and decorate with a little mint on top.

Notes

  • Depending on your taste, use less water for a thicker drink, or more for a lighter drink.
